How they compare

Peru currently reports 104,870 t against 103,576 t in Republic of Korea, a difference of 1,294 t.

The two have swapped places 3 times across 63 shared years of data; in 1961 it was Republic of Korea ahead.

Peru ranks 39th and Republic of Korea ranks 41st of 186 countries.

Across the 7 decades both report, Peru averaged higher in 2 and Republic of Korea in 5.

Head to head by decade

Decade Peru Republic of Korea Difference Ahead
1960s 33,426 t 77,604 t 44,178 t Republic of Korea
1970s 45,815 t 131,379 t 85,564 t Republic of Korea
1980s 49,376 t 143,044 t 93,668 t Republic of Korea
1990s 56,617 t 166,001 t 109,384 t Republic of Korea
2000s 91,146 t 132,159 t 41,013 t Republic of Korea
2010s 115,288 t 101,391 t 13,898 t Peru
2020s 123,351 t 106,862 t 16,490 t Peru

Averages of every year both report within each decade.

The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
